It is and the name of this type of investment is a property option. Here, you invest your money into buying the right to buy the property. In the time that you own that right, you still profit from any increase in value that the property sees. Additionally, you invest little, make your decision about whether to buy the property later and you can get started quickly.
Property options are a type of tool that has been around for a long time.
